What is Sleep Deprivation?   
Sleep deprivation is a lack of the necessary amount of sleep. This may occur as a result of sleep disorders, active choice or deliberate inducement.
Sleep Deprivation Symptoms
 
It is very important to understand what are the symptoms of sleep deprivation, and how to detect sleep deprivation. 
 
Sleep deprivation affects our health. Sleep affects more than most people realize, and if you do not receive an adequate sleep then you could set yourself to a range of health risks, or even put your life in danger.

One of the most easily identifiable signs of sleep deprivation is fatigue or sleepiness during the day. We all understand intuitively that if we do not get enough sleep and we do not feel fit the next day.
 
Another sleep deprivation symptom is a decrease in memory and mental performance. We may experience a decline in the memory due to lack of sleep. Studies on sleep have shown that leadership in a time which suffers from lack of sleep is similar to driving under the influence. It is estimated that tens of thousands of car accidents occur each year because of sleepiness.
 
There are the effects of behavioral and sleep deprivation as well. Sleep can affect levels of chemicals in the brain at work, which in turn can alter mood and mental health. People who suffer from lack of sleep and often forms of anxiety and other psychological effects. It also reduces your ability to deal with stress.
 
The amount of actual sleep we need vary from person to person. Some people need 4 to 5 hours of sleep and feel refreshed and others may need more than 8 hours sound sleep. To find out if you have sleep deprivation symptoms, you need to consider your body’s requirements. You need to ask yourself the following questions:
 
  • Do you feel exhausted the whole day?
  • Are you unable to concentrate and speak coherently?
  • Do you find it difficult to remember latest events?
  • Do you feel sleepy during day?
 
If your answers is yes to any of the above questions, you may be suffering from sleep deprivation.  
Signs of Sleep Deprivation: 
Some of the most common signs of sleep deprivation are: 

 1. Irritability, edginess

 2. Blurred vision

 3. Activity intolerance

 4. Alterations in appetite

 5. Behavioral, learning or social problems

 6. Inability to tolerate stress

 7. Tiredness

 8. Feeling sleepy in the day

 9. Problems with concentration and memory

10. Frequent infections
